| Emerson announces Model 56 liquid analyzer | ||
|
||
August 17, 2011 – Emerson Process Management released the Rosemount Analytical Model 56, an advanced dual-input liquid analyzer with a high-resolution color screen. The Model 56 features extensive full-color trend graphics, advanced control capabilities, a high capacity data logger and audit trail event logger, and digital communications.
The Model 56 provides four independent 4-20 mA outputs that can be configured for measurements or proportional, integral, derivative (PID) control. Four relays are provided with discrete capability including:
To transmit data to the plant’s PLCs, SCADA or DCS systems, the Model 56 is supplied with either HART or PROFIBUS DP digital communications. HART communications versions 5 and 7 protocols are standard on all configurations. HART can also be easily commissioned onto a WirelessHART network using the Smart Wireless THUM Adaptor, enabling wireless transmission of process variables and diagnostics from hard-to-reach locations.
“These capabilities make the Model 56 appropriate for power, water treatment, pharmaceutical and food processing applications that require liquid analytical measurements and need advanced control capabilities,” said Dave Anderson, Marketing Director, Emerson Process Management, Rosemount Analytical. “Specific applications that would benefit from the advanced capabilities include: cooling towers in the power industry; reverse osmosis in the water treatment industry; wastewater treatment in the drinking water industry; clean-in-place in the food processing industry; and many others.” |
